Subject: Re: [PATCH v15 4/6] fpga: image-load: add status ioctl

On Wed, Sep 08, 2021 at 07:18:44PM -0700, Russ Weight wrote:
> Extend the FPGA Image Load class driver to include an
> FPGA_IMAGE_LOAD_STATUS IOCTL that can be used to monitor the progress
> of an ongoing image load.  The status returned includes how much data
> remains to be transferred, the progress of the image load, and error
> information in the case of a failure.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Russ Weight <russell.h.weight@...el.com>
> ---
> V15:
>  - This patch is new to the patchset and provides an FPGA_IMAGE_LOAD_STATUS
>    IOCTL to return the current values for: remaining_size, progress,
>    err_progress, and err_code.
>  - This patch has elements of the following three patches from the previous
>    patch-set:
>      [PATCH v14 3/6] fpga: sec-mgr: expose sec-mgr update status
>      [PATCH v14 4/6] fpga: sec-mgr: expose sec-mgr update errors
>      [PATCH v14 5/6] fpga: sec-mgr: expose sec-mgr update size
>  - Changed file, symbol, and config names to reflect the new driver name
>  - There are some minor changes to locking to enable this ioctl to return
>    coherent data.
> ---
>  Documentation/fpga/fpga-image-load.rst |  6 +++
>  drivers/fpga/fpga-image-load.c         | 53 ++++++++++++++++++++++----
>  include/uapi/linux/fpga-image-load.h   | 18 +++++++++
>  3 files changed, 70 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)
